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package alsa-utils for openSUSE:Factory checked in at 2024-11-15 15:37:57 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/alsa-utils (Old) and /work/SRC/openSUSE:Factory/.alsa-utils.new.2017 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"alsa-utils" Fri Nov 15 15:37:57 2024 rev:148 rq:1224146 version:1.2.13 Changes: -------- --- /work/SRC/openSUSE:Factory/alsa-utils/alsa-utils.changes 2024-11-13 15:27:12.930591279 +0100 +++ /work/SRC/openSUSE:Factory/.alsa-utils.new.2017/alsa-utils.changes 2024-11-15 15:38:05.317475939 +0100 @@ -1,0 +2,6 @@ +Thu Nov 14 09:02:51 UTC 2024 - Takashi Iwai <[email protected]> + +- Fix alsactl restore error (bsc#1233353): + 0001-alsactl-90-alsa-restore.rules-fix-alsa_restore_go-st.patch + +------------------------------------------------------------------- New: ---- 0001-alsactl-90-alsa-restore.rules-fix-alsa_restore_go-st.patch BETA DEBUG BEGIN: New:- Fix alsactl restore error (bsc#1233353): 0001-alsactl-90-alsa-restore.rules-fix-alsa_restore_go-st.patch BETA DEBUG END: 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 alsa-utils.spec ++++++ --- /var/tmp/diff_new_pack.tY5d6a/_old 2024-11-15 15:38:06.057506935 +0100 +++ /var/tmp/diff_new_pack.tY5d6a/_new 2024-11-15 15:38:06.061507102 +0100 @@ -44,6 +44,7 @@ # from https://www.alsa-project.org/files/pub/gpg-release-key-v1.txt Source6: alsa-utils.keyring # upstream fixes +Patch1: 0001-alsactl-90-alsa-restore.rules-fix-alsa_restore_go-st.patch # downstream fixes Patch100: alsa-info-no-update-for-distro-script.patch Patch101: alsa-utils-configure-version-revert.patch @@ -90,6 +91,7 @@ %prep %setup -q +%patch -P 1 -p1 %patch -P 100 -p1 %if 0%{?do_autoreconf} || 0%{?build_from_git} %patch -P 101 -p1 ++++++ 0001-alsactl-90-alsa-restore.rules-fix-alsa_restore_go-st.patch ++++++ >From f90124c73edd050b24961197a4abcf17e53b41a8 Mon Sep 17 00:00:00 2001 From: Jaroslav Kysela <[email protected]> Date: Thu, 14 Nov 2024 09:38:49 +0100 Subject: [PATCH] alsactl: 90-alsa-restore.rules - fix alsa_restore_go/std Fix the label mismatch which was introduced in the transition from the temporary test rules. Closes: https://github.com/alsa-project/alsa-utils/issues/280 Fixes: 8116639 ("alsactl: 90-alsa-restore.rules - add support for AMD ACP digital microphone") Signed-off-by: Jaroslav Kysela <[email protected]> --- alsactl/90-alsa-restore.rules.in |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/alsactl/90-alsa-restore.rules.in b/alsactl/90-alsa-restore.rules.in index 85f0b15f4856..dae2ed8ccc8f 100644 --- a/alsactl/90-alsa-restore.rules.in +++ b/alsactl/90-alsa-restore.rules.in @@ -3,6 +3,8 @@ ACTION=="add", SUBSYSTEM=="sound", KERNEL=="controlC*", KERNELS!="card*",@extratest@ GOTO="alsa_restore_go" GOTO="alsa_restore_end" +LABEL="alsa_restore_go" + ENV{ALSA_CARD_NUMBER}="$attr{device/number}" # mark HDA analog card; HDMI/DP card does not have capture devices @@ -21,7 +23,7 @@ TEST!="/run/udev/alsa-hda-analog-card", GOTO="alsa_restore_std" IMPORT{program}="/usr/bin/cat /run/udev/alsa-hda-analog-card" ENV{ALSA_CARD_HDA_ANALOG}!="", ENV{ALSA_CARD_NUMBER}="$env{ALSA_CARD_HDA_ANALOG}" -LABEL="alsa_restore_go" +LABEL="alsa_restore_std" TEST!="@daemonswitch@", RUN+="@sbindir@/alsactl@args@ restore $env{ALSA_CARD_NUMBER}" TEST=="@daemonswitch@", RUN+="@sbindir@/alsactl@args@ nrestore $env{ALSA_CARD_NUMBER}" -- 2.43.0
